Dehradun, 16 Dec: Experts from Graphic Era are training women in orchid production. This training programme began at Graphic Era Deemed University, here, today.
Women from various parts of the state are participating in this 2-day training programme. Vice Chancellor Dr Narpinder Singh addressed the farmers today. He said that preservation of medicinal plants, flowers, fruits and traditional cuisine found in the state can be turned into profitable business. For this, farmers should be trained in various techniques and technologies. Director, IQAS, Dr Santosh S Saraf said that women play an important role in farming. They should be encouraged to get training and start business in orchid farming.
HoD, Department of Biotechnology, Dr Manu Pant said that orchid farming is an excellent source of income as orchid plants are sold for about 800-1500 rupees in the market. Out of 236 species found in Uttarakhand, 17 species are used for medicinal purposes. She provided detailed information about different types of orchids including Aerides multiflora, Rhynchostylis retusa, Cymbidium and Cattleya.
HoD, Management Studies, Dr Navneet Rawat highlighted important aspects of ethical farming.
The training programme is being organized by Department of Biotechnology and Department of Management Studies in collaboration with Agriculture Department’s Uttarakhand Council for Biotechnology. Co-Principal Investigator Kartikey Raina and PhD scholars were also present at the training programme.
